Asbestos is a natural fiber that was utilized in a variety of Navy shipbuilding and repair projects. The Navy employed asbestos in shipyards and on vessels because it was cheap and non-corrosive, as well as soundproof. Asbestos was a popular material used by Navy veterans in shipyards, on Navy vessels, and during repairs and overhauls.

Navy veterans diagnosed with mesothelioma might be qualified for disability benefits from the Department of Veterans Affairs. Veterans who have been affected by asbestos may also receive compensation from asbestos producers.

Asbestos is a hazard and carcinogenic material that was discovered in a variety of US Navy vessels built prior to the 1980s. Navy veterans who worked on these vessels might have been exposed to asbestos if they handled or manipulated the materials. Asbestos fibres would then fly in the air, and other people could breathe them in. Navy personnel may have brought asbestos fibers on their skin or clothing home. If family members touch the veteran's clothes or hair, they could be exposed.
